Purpose of the Shaker
When shaking a cocktail, the goal is to chill the mixture rapidly and add just the right amount of water from the melting ice. This dilution helps soften the alcohol while enhancing flavor integration. Shaking also aerates the drink, creating a lighter texture and smoother mouthfeel. Cocktails such as Daiquiris, Margaritas, Whiskey Sours, and Cosmopolitans rely entirely on the shaker for their final character.
Building the Cocktail
To prepare a Daiquiri, begin by adding 60 ml of light rum, 30 ml of simple syrup, and 30 ml of fresh lime juice into the shaker. Adding ingredients before ice helps maintain control and reduces unnecessary dilution. Once ingredients are inside, add ice gently so the mixture does not splash.
Sealing the Shaker
Place the lid securely on top of the shaker. A good seal ensures the shaker does not leak during use. Press around the edges to verify that the lid is tight. A correct seal is vital for a clean and efficient shake.
Shaking Technique
Hold the shaker using one hand on the base and the other on the lid, keeping your index finger over the top for stability. Shake vigorously for about 10 seconds. The shaker should move in a consistent rhythm, allowing the ice to travel from one end to the other. This motion chills the drink quickly and helps incorporate air, creating a bright and refreshing flavor.
Opening the Shaker
Sometimes the lid can stick due to pressure differences caused by temperature. If a simple twist and pull does not open it, place both thumbs under the edge and push upward to break the seal. This technique is safe and requires minimal effort.
Straining and Pouring
You may pour directly from the shaker by holding the lid in place. For a cleaner pour and to prevent ice or pulp from entering the glass, use a Hawthorne strainer. Place it over the shaker and pour the drink steadily into the serving glass.
